Summary

The San Diego Padres are reportedly contemplating the trade of two-time All-Star closer Mason Miller as the Aug. 3 MLB trade deadline approaches. ESPN analysts describe the potential move as 'tantalizing,' given Miller’s status as one of the few elite available closers, particularly with the Red Sox unlikely to trade Aroldis Chapman. While the Padres sit two games out of the National League Wild Card standings, some sources predict that Miller will be moved to strengthen their rotation, while others express skepticism about a trade, citing his value and recent performance. Miller has recorded 25 saves this season and has three years of arbitration eligibility remaining.
